Flexible Accommodation: Hotels are designed to cater to the needs and preferences of a diverse range of individuals. They offer a variety of room options, from standard rooms to luxurious suites, allowing retirees to choose accommodations that suit their lifestyle and budget. Moreover, hotels typically offer flexible lease terms, allowing retirees the freedom to stay short-term or long-term, depending on their desires. 2. Amenities and Services: One of the major advantages of retiring in a hotel is the range of amenities and services available. Hotels often boast world-class facilities such as swimming pools, fitness centers, spa services, restaurants, and 24-hour concierge services. These amenities enhance the retirement experience and provide retirees with a luxurious and convenient lifestyle. 3. Socialization and Community: Hotels attract a diverse group of guests, creating a vibrant social environment for retirees. Engaging with fellow guests from different backgrounds and cultures can lead to fulfilling friendships and a sense of community. Furthermore, many hotels organize social events, activities, and classes, which allow retirees to stay active, meet like-minded individuals, and participate in hobbies or learn new skills. 4. Location and Accessibility: Hotels are often strategically located in prime areas, close to tourist attractions, shopping centers, and cultural landmarks. This means retirees can enjoy easy access to entertainment, dining, and cultural experiences without the need for extensive travel. Additionally, hotels are usually designed to be accessible for individuals with mobility issues, providing a worry-free living environment for retirees. 5. Peace of Mind: Another advantage of retiring in a hotel is the peace of mind that comes with it. Hotels prioritize security and provide round-the-clock surveillance, ensuring a safe and secure environment for retirees. Additionally, hotels handle housekeeping, maintenance, and other necessary services, relieving retirees of caretaking responsibilities and allowing them to focus on enjoying their retirement.
